Transaction 617284128990324671f9480075c9ff7a2d8b8a1aeca2bb0e1968edd0d4e38c54
1 Input
1 Output
-
617284128990324671f9480075c9ff7a2d8b8a1aeca2bb0e1968edd0d4e38c54:0
- value
- 543527
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c3b6fddc1b19546c8f92fc8a258c131b3ea4546 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Kct3tSsWs8kwtvm3QJ4oMcWpCSjaKSgQn